1. Early Life & Family Background

Caleb Khristopher Love was born on September 27, 2001, in St. Louis, Missouri. He grew up in a sports-centered family where athletic competition and academics went hand in hand.

  • Parents: His father is Dennis Love and his mother is Alecia Thompson

  • His father played college football, which gave Caleb early exposure to athletic discipline and competitive sports. 

  • Caleb was an honors student growing up, reflecting strong performance both on and off the court.

3. High School Basketball Career

Caleb Love attended Christian Brothers College High School in St. Louis, Missouri — a school with a rich basketball heritage.

During his high school career:

  • Love became one of the most decorated high school players in Missouri

  • He averaged 26.3 points, 6.5 rebounds, and 3.1 assists as a senior, showcasing scoring ability and leadership. 

  • Love was a McDonald’s All-American selection, one of the highest honors in high school basketball. 

  • He scored a career-best 42 points in a single game and became only the second player in school history to surpass 2,000 career points

This dominance set the stage for his college recruitment, where he was a highly ranked national prospect.


4. College Journey: UNC & Arizona

North Carolina (UNC)

Caleb Love began his collegiate career at the University of North Carolina (UNC) — one of the most prestigious basketball programs in the U.S.

At UNC:

  • Love quickly became a key contributor as a freshman.

  • He displayed leadership, scoring, and clutch shooting against top competition. 

Transfer to Arizona

After three seasons with UNC (2020–23), Love transferred to the University of Arizona:

  • At Arizona, he elevated his production and earned major accolades.

  • In the 2023–24 season, Love was named Pac-12 Player of the Year

  • In the 2024–25 campaign, he earned First-Team All-Big 12 honors, continuing his impactful play.

5. Caleb Love College Stats & Achievements

Across his college career, Caleb Love compiled impressive numbers:

Career College Stats

  • Across 174 games (169 starts) over five seasons at UNC and Arizona:

    • 15.9 points per game

    • 3.8 rebounds per game

    • 3.4 assists per game

    • 1.1 steals per game 

Key Highlights

  • Pac-12 Player of the Year (2023–24) 

  • First-Team All-Big 12 (2024–25) 

  • One of the few players in NCAA history to score 1,000+ points at two different Division I schools

While Love’s shooting efficiency wasn’t always elite, his scoring volume and impact were undeniable in college.


6. NBA Draft 2025: What Happened

Despite strong collegiate production, Caleb Love went undrafted in the 2025 NBA Draft — a surprising outcome for many fans. 

Reasons analysts cite include:

  • Concerns about efficiency and decision-making.

  • Questions about his role projection at the NBA level — combo guard vs. playmaker.

  • A deep 2025 draft class reducing opportunities for borderline prospects.

However, not being drafted did not mark the end of his NBA dreams.


7. Professional Career & Two-Way Contract

Shortly after the draft, Caleb Love signed a two-way contract with the Portland Trail Blazers.

Contract Details

  • Signed a two-way deal, meaning he splits time between the NBA roster and the Rip City Remix (G League)

  • He’s eligible to play up to 50 NBA games while still gaining development time. 

  • Expected earnings reported around $636,435 in base salary (approximately half the NBA rookie minimum)

This structure is common for undrafted rookies who show potential but need seasoning before full-time NBA minutes.


8. NBA Stats & Playing Style

Caleb Love’s early NBA season stats show a young player finding his footing:

2025–26 NBA Regular Season (Portland Trail Blazers)

  • Points per game: ~7.9

  • Rebounds: ~2.4

  • Assists: ~2.0

  • FG %: ~34-36%

  • 3P %: ~26-28%

  • FT %: ~78-79% 

These numbers reflect a bench role with limited minutes, but there are flashes of scoring ability.

Playing Style

  • Love is known as a combo guard with creation and scoring instincts.

  • Strengths include shot creation, fearless scoring, and competitive fire.

  • Areas for improvement: efficiency, shot selection, and defensive impact.

Even with inconsistencies, coaches value his ability to put points on the board.
